The recipe for these s'mores is easy and actually the only kind of s'mores that Darin likes.</div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
<b>S'mores Bars</b></div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
3/4 c karo syrup</div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
3 Tbsp butter</div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
1 pkg chocolate chips</div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
1 tsp vanilla </div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
1 large box Golden Grahams</div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
3 cups marshmallows</div>
<br />
<div style="text-align: center;">
In a medium saucepan heat butter, karo syrup and chocolate chips over low heat until melted. Add vanilla and stir. Pour over cereal and stir to coat. Add in marshmallows and stir to combine. Let cool on wax paper. Enjoy. </div>

To make your own Love Struck bobby pins you need just some tiny scraps of material >> ours are leather and felt << bobby pins and a hot glue gun. To make two bobby pins you will need 3 small squares of material. </div>
<div style="text-align: center;">
Take the first square and cut it in half diagonally. This gives you the two arrowheads. With the second square, first cut a triangle notch out of the top. Then cut the bottom corners off at an angle to make a point. Carefully snip the sides of your square to give it a feather look. Repeat with the third square. These are your arrow tails. All that is left is to hot glue the arrowheads and tails to the top of your bobby pins.</div>

Start by cutting strips of paper to your desired width and fold them in half. For the patterned paper I cut two inch strips. Using a paper slicer angle the folded strips and cut in to increments. You can either cut them all the same or vary the width. You will have some extra triangles at the ends that you can either save for another project ;) or recycle them. </div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
Open up the folded cuts and get excited! YAY! Arrows! </div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
You can either stitch them together along the top or punch small holes and string them together. Just make sure the arrows all point the same direction.</div>

First we braided Ivy's bangs so they would stay back. That part is completely optional. </div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
Start by putting the hair in to two high and wide pigtails. Braid each pigtail and secure the ends with those tiny clear elastics. Take the right braid and bring it down and to the left one, tucking the end in the left braid's rubberband. With the left braid sweep it up and to the right, tucking it into the right ponytail. We used bobby pins to hold the braids in place better too. This gives you the football shape!</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
For the laces you will need white ribbon, bobby pins and a glue gun. Cut one long ribbon and 3-4 short ribbons. The lengths of these depend on your childs head, so don't forget to measure, or at least eyeball it. Hot glue the shorter ribbons to the bobby pins and then glue those to the longer piece of ribbon. When the glue is dry, slide the bobby pins down into the hair to secure the laces. </div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
With a couple more pieces of ribbon you can weave it in the ends to mimic the ends of a football. I didn't do a great job of this, but you get the idea right?!</div>

Supplies...</div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
a scrap of leather, wood plaque, paint, furniture tack or small nail, branch.</div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
I collected all of these things from my craft room and the the branch I got from a tree in my backyard making it free, which I love. If you don't have a black hole called The Craft Room then you can get the plaques for $1-2 at a craft store and while you are there you can get a grab bag of leather scraps. I promise you will find other ways to use the leather. </div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EjtXlyU4VtBvvLq6QvDsTAQxXxaWfNUb-epELHrKQnH-IuWozghgFKmMJkHxxgX5r1UwyPKa-0k-lnKc0VI9ASfJBnd8gW37rwub-wUVDRBEeVYzcZbDY13ZwqyrTpCytIIwi0u7_er7G0/s1600/IMG_0090.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="margin-left: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" height="640"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EjtXlyU4VtBvvLq6QvDsTAQxXxaWfNUb-epELHrKQnH-IuWozghgFKmMJkHxxgX5r1UwyPKa-0k-lnKc0VI9ASfJBnd8gW37rwub-wUVDRBEeVYzcZbDY13ZwqyrTpCytIIwi0u7_er7G0/s640/IMG_0090.jpg" width="480" /></a></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
Start by painting your plaque. While it is drying cut a piece of leather long enough to make a circle to fit around your branch. Using a hammer, pound your nail in each end of the leather to punch holes. </div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Egj5nKNYvyudr_uZ4OSOcml9oGUqXF8C169RSQTvw9dgWx_cfOE98__dcSK6ZWvn-MuUCy3Hb4OzUXQfbjJ6neeDmbZdBl4McvN_InystVUL6p8KM1e-8olWPdny2gx-EN-skCwZ7bie-U/s1600/IMG_0091.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="margin-left: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" height="640"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Egj5nKNYvyudr_uZ4OSOcml9oGUqXF8C169RSQTvw9dgWx_cfOE98__dcSK6ZWvn-MuUCy3Hb4OzUXQfbjJ6neeDmbZdBl4McvN_InystVUL6p8KM1e-8olWPdny2gx-EN-skCwZ7bie-U/s640/IMG_0091.jpg" width="480" /></a></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
Put your tack through the holes to make a loop and then pound it into the plaque.</div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hsbDbrjlEo4E_iLHrGB6Redq06ttcNafyZISQi9GHvqsuwe9aGyMk5s2qUhifQN2mzmUnzRmX6KMO9cX1dvCALtUe9XpfjAxE9TVKl4Gurq7YQoRMK3u1n7QrhJ-YaI51v-VacnTB59mU/s1600/IMG_0088.jpg" imageanchor="1" style="margin-left: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" height="640"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EhsbDbrjlEo4E_iLHrGB6Redq06ttcNafyZISQi9GHvqsuwe9aGyMk5s2qUhifQN2mzmUnzRmX6KMO9cX1dvCALtUe9XpfjAxE9TVKl4Gurq7YQoRMK3u1n7QrhJ-YaI51v-VacnTB59mU/s640/IMG_0088.jpg" width="480" /></a></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<br /></div>
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: left;">
Set your branch into the loop and just like that you've made branchlers. </div>
